Thanks for the response.  I've updated my local JiBX from CVS as you
suggested, but, neither option appears to work.  Both return this
message:

     [bind] Error: No compatible mapping defined for type
java.lang.String; on structure element at (line 6, col 96, in
JiBX/bin/CollectionAttributeItemTest-binding.xml)

Perhaps there's still a piece missing?  The modified binding file
(sporting the contained-element-with-type attribute option) is below.

...Leif
----------------
<binding>
  <mapping name="document" class="test.MyDocument">
    <structure name="elementItemList">
      <collection field="elementItemList" 
          factory="org.jibx.runtime.Utility.arrayListFactory">
        <structure name="item" value-style="element" usage="optional"  
          type="java.lang.String"/>
      </collection>
    </structure>
    <structure name="attributeItemList">
      <collection field="attributeItemList" 
          factory="org.jibx.runtime.Utility.arrayListFactory">
        <structure name="item" value-style="attribute" usage="optional">
          <value name="code" style="attribute" type="java.lang.String"/>
        </structure>
      </collection>
    </structure>
  </mapping>
</binding>
